Rust Itself Isn’t the Real Problem – What Lives Around It Is

Rust does not cause tetanus. Many people grow up believing they will get tetanus from stepping on a rusty nail, and while a puncture wound from a nail is something to take seriously, you don’t get tetanus from rust. That’s one of the most persistent myths in home safety, and it matters because it gives people the wrong idea about where the real danger lies.

Puncture wounds from rusty nails, screws, or barbed wire are often associated with tetanus risk, but it’s not the rust itself that’s the culprit. Tetanus bacteria thrive in environments lacking oxygen, such as soil, dust, and feces. Rust, however, creates a rough surface that can harbor dirt and debris, increasing the likelihood of bacterial contamination. When a rusty object pierces the skin, it can drive these contaminants deep into tissues, creating an ideal anaerobic environment for tetanus spores to germinate and produce toxins.

The Bacteria Living in Your Garden Soil

The most common and well-known infection risk is tetanus, caused by Clostridium tetani, which lives in soil and manure. Infections occur through contamination of cuts and scrapes caused by things in contact with the soil, such as garden tools or rose thorns. This is a bacteria that doesn’t need light or oxygen to survive, which makes garden soil a particularly hospitable home for it.

The bacteria make spores so they can survive harsh environments. The spores of Clostridium tetani exhibit exceptional resistance to elevated temperatures, various antiseptic agents, and prolonged boiling. When conditions are favorable, these spores germinate. In practical terms, this means the bacteria can be sitting dormant in your flower bed for years, waiting for exactly the kind of wound that a rough or rusty garden tool can cause.

Gardening Is One of the Most Common Sources of Tetanus Cases

The CDC reports that a third of all tetanus cases originate from gardening injuries. That’s a significant share of cases tied directly to an everyday hobby. Two recent reports from the US Centers for Disease Control and Prevention found hundreds of tetanus cases and dozens of deaths over 15 years, along with four cases in children in 2024 alone.

Where reported, roughly seven in ten injuries that led to tetanus infection occurred in the home and garden setting. These aren’t industrial accidents or extreme outdoor situations. They’re the ordinary scrapes and punctures that happen when people tend their yards without thinking about what’s already in the soil or on their tools.

What Tetanus Actually Does to the Body

Tetanus is a bacterial infection caused by Clostridium tetani, a type of bacteria that lives in soil, dust, and animal feces. When these bacteria enter the body through a cut or puncture, they release a toxin that affects the nervous system. Tetanus causes painful muscle stiffness, difficulty swallowing, and severe spasms. The experience is far more serious than many people imagine from its casual mention in everyday conversation.

Tetanus is the most dangerous of these infections and is characterized by uncontrollable, intense muscle spasms. Classically, but not always, some of the first affected muscles are those that close the jaw, giving the infection the nickname “lockjaw.” The typical incubation period is eight days, but some reported cases have emerged up to three weeks after exposure. Tetanus is fatal in about 10% of cases but causes muscle spasms, fever, and trouble swallowing in all cases.

Even Small Wounds from Garden Tools Are a Real Concern

Tetanus is a dangerous infection, and it doesn’t take an emergency room-level injury to contract it. Even small wounds – like splinters, bug bites, or garden scratches – can let in the bacteria. This is a critical point that most gardeners miss entirely.

Many kinds of injuries can lead to tetanus. Puncture wounds are a classic example, but lacerations, fractures that break the skin, burns, crush injuries, and even relatively minor cuts can also pose a risk if they are contaminated with dirt or debris. A glancing scrape from a rusty trowel edge while turning compost is the exact kind of low-drama moment that people brush off and then forget about.

How Rusty Tools Become More Dangerous Over Time

Over time, rust can form on garden tools, reducing their effectiveness and potentially compromising safety. A corroded blade doesn’t just perform poorly – its uneven, pitted surface is significantly harder to clean and disinfect than a smooth, well-maintained one. Using rusted pruners, shears, knives, or loppers can result in torn plant tissue, poor cuts that invite disease, and even injuries from slipping or jagged edges.

Rust forms through oxidation when moisture meets metal. If tools are stored damp or dirty, corrosion begins and weakens the metal over time. A shovel left leaning against a shed wall after rain, or a trowel tossed into a bucket and forgotten for weeks – these are the habits that gradually transform useful tools into hazards.

When to Actually Go to the ER – and When Urgent Care Will Do

You should worry if the cut is deep, won’t stop bleeding, or becomes red, swollen, or painful. These might need medical attention. Go to the ER for deep wounds, uncontrolled bleeding, bone exposure, numbness, or if you can’t move a part of your body. These are the clear markers that separate a manageable cut from something more urgent.

If you have any symptoms of tetanus, go to the nearest emergency room. Tetanus can be dangerous without proper treatment. For less severe wounds where tetanus vaccination may simply be outdated, talking to your healthcare provider or visiting an urgent care clinic is often sufficient. An urgent care facility or your primary care provider’s office can give you the booster at the same time as treating your injury.

How to Clean and Protect Your Garden Tools – and Yourself

A simple and effective way to take the rust off your gardening tools is an overnight soak in vinegar. The acetic acid in vinegar will break down the rust and make it easier to scrub away. For more persistent corrosion, steel wool is effective for removing stubborn spots and rust, and a scrub brush is helpful for broader surfaces.

If rust spots have gone all the way through the metal, those tools are done and no longer safe to use. Adding a light coating of oil after every clean protects the metal from the elements and prevents further rusting. Beyond the tools themselves, protection from the tetanus vaccine decreases over time, so the CDC recommends getting a routine tetanus shot every 10 years – and if you suffer a high-risk wound involving soil contamination, the CDC recommends receiving a tetanus vaccine if your most recent vaccine is more than five years old.
